In Problems 55-62, find the particular antiderivative of each derivative that satisfies the given condition.
55. C'(x) = 9x^2 - 20x; C(10) = 2,500
56. R'(x) = 500 - 0.4x; R(0) = 0
57. dx/dt = 10/βt; x(1) = 25
58. dR/dt = 50/t^3; R(1) = 50
59. f'(x) = 4x^-2 - 3x^-1 + 2; f(1) = 5
60. f'(x) = x^-1 - 2x^-2 + 1; f(1) = 5
61. dy/dt = 6e^t - 7; y(0) = 0
62. dy/dt = 3 - 2e^t; y(0) = 2
